Please help me to explain this answer.

The top side of circular medallion made of a circular piece of colored glass is surrounded by a metal frame. If the radius of the medallion is r centimeters and the width of the metal frame is s centimeters, then in terms of s and r, what is the area of the metal frame in square centimeters?

The answer is: pi*s*(2r-s)

Pi r^2 -(r-s)^2 which gives the desired result.

The top side of the medallion is the part outside the smaller circle. Give you metal frame the circumference of the bigger circle, that is the same as surrounding the top side- the space between the 2 circles with the a metal frame. The trap is to consider the smaller circle as having radiur r. It is the big circle that has r, so that the difference between that r and width s will give the radius of smaller circle.
